ZIP 19082 is a ZIP code of 41,541 people in Delaware County. The foreign-born share is 34%. Density works out to 16,132 people per square mile. 49% of homes are owner-occupied. Four-year degrees are less common here than nationally, at 23% of adults. This skews young, with a median age of 33.9. Among the 37 ZIP codes in Delaware County, 19082 ranks 33rd by median household income.
